Abstract

AbstractDeprotonation of N,N’-dicyclohexylformamidine with methyl lithium yields dicyclohexylformamidinyl lithium (8a).The X-ray crystal structure analysis of 8ashows an unsymmetically formamidinato-bridged THF-stabilized dimer in the crystal. Treatment of diphenylformamidinyl lithium (8b) with Cp2ZrCl2 gives the (K2 N, N’ -dicyclohexylformamidinato Cp2ZrCH3 (7a). Treatment of (K2 N, N’ -diphenylformamidinato)Cp2ZrCH3 (7b) with [Bu3NH+][BPh4−] gave the salt [(K2 N, N’ -diphenylformamidinato)Cp2Zr+][BPh4 −] (9B). Its X-ray crystal structure analysis revealed a symmetrical bonding of the formamidinato ligand to the zirconium metal center.
